IND vs ENG Highlights: India’s hopes of clinching a famous victory at Lord’s were dashed on the final day of the third Test, as England held their nerve to register a tense 22-run win and take a 2-1 lead in the five-match series. Despite a valiant effort from Ravindra Jadeja (61), India fell short in their chase of 193, ending an intense battle at the home of cricket.

India, chasing a target of 193, were reeling at 112/8 by the end of the first session. From that dire position, a remarkable resistance followed, spearheaded by Ravindra Jadeja’s determined half-century.

He was ably supported by No. 10 Jasprit Bumrah and No. 11 Mohammed Siraj, who displayed incredible grit and defiance against England’s bowling attack.

The trio dragged the game deep into the final session, keeping India’s hopes flickering. However, just when it seemed the tide might turn, Siraj was dismissed in unfortunate fashion in the 75th over, ending India’s innings at 170 all out, and falling 22 runs short of what would have been a historic chase.

Disastrous start to Day 5

India endured a disastrous start to Day 5 of the high-stakes third Test at Lord’s, losing three key wickets in under 40 minutes.

Rishabh Pant, KL Rahul, and Washington Sundar all fell in quick succession during the opening session, pushing India into serious trouble and putting their hopes of back-to-back Test wins in England under immense threat.

Jofra Archer delivered a fiery spell with the ball, dismissing Pant with a delivery that jagged in sharply and then pulling off a spectacular catch to send Sundar packing. The pressure kept mounting as KL Rahul fell soon after, trapped by a sharp piece of thinking from England skipper Ben Stokes, who nailed a timely DRS review to get the decision in his team’s favour.

After KL Rahul’s dismissal, Washington Sundar followed soon after, departing for a duck. Nitish Kumar Reddy tried to steady the innings with some resistance, but his stay at the crease was cut short by Chris Woakes, who got him out for 13.

Despite the top and middle order collapsing, Jasprit Bumrah and Mohammed Siraj stepped up with valuable support for Ravindra Jadeja, helping India inch closer to what would have been a famous chase at Lord’s.

However, just as India neared the finish line, a cruel twist of fate saw Siraj dismissed under unfortunate circumstances, ending the dream. With that wicket, England clinched a dramatic victory and took a 2-1 lead in the five-match Test series.
